This week we will be exploring Genesis 44 together, Love According to God. Can people truly change? It is a good question. Sometimes we see someone set in their ways and we don't think that they will ever change. Sometimes we look at our own lives and realize how hard it is to change. This Sunday, September 7 (9am, 10:45am), we will have a special guest speaker for our Genesis series, Dr. Terry Mortenson of Answers in Genesis. Dr. Mortenson has a Ph.D. in the history of geology from Coventry University in the UK. He has taught on creation and evolution issues for over 50 years in 37 different countries.
